Ugly face of speed camera rage Chris Thomson January 2, 2009 The alleged offender tries to wrench the Multanova from its mounting. Police are trying to track down a man who repeatedly smashed a Multanova against a Swanbourne lamp post on December 30. Police Media's Ros Weatherall said the vandalism occurred about 4.50pm. "One of our camera operators was monitoring northbound traffic on the West Coast Highway adjacent to Swansea street in Swanbourne," Ms Weatherall said. "He's seen a man standing nearby at a bus stop paying attention to the Multanova and kept an eye on him because he appeared suspicious. "The man walked to the Multanova, disconnected the battery to the camera, before picking the Multanova up and repeatedly smashing it against the lamp post." Ms Weatherall said the man fled along West Coast Highway before running down Lynton Street. She said the Multanova was destroyed and would cost taxpayers $200,000 to replace. The man had tanned skin, was between 35 and 40 years old, was 178cm tall, of solid build, and had short shaved hair. He was wearing a white tank top and dark shorts.
